Maurice Murphy Obituary

1940 - 2021
Maurice Anthony Murphy, age 81, died peacefully with his daughter, Margaret Mary McQuillan by his bedside, on St. Patrick's Day, his favorite holiday, March 17, 2021, in his beloved New York City, New York.

"Murph", as he was known by those who loved him, was born in the Bronx, New York, on January 23, 1940 to his parents, Beatrice Heffernan from Crossmolina, County Mayo and Bryan Murphy from County Kerry, Ireland. He attended St. Nicholas of Tolentine School and graduated from Villanova University. Upon graduation from college, he enlisted in the Army where he was honorably discharged following the death of his father. He married Mary Slane in 1965. They had three children together, Elizabeth, Douglas and Margaret Mary, and later divorced. Murph went on to live on the upper east side of Manhattan, a neighborhood that he loved and where he had many dear friends.

Having a long career in life insurance, Murph worked for Aetna, John Hancock Insurance Company, and Bankers Life Insurance, to name a few. After retiring, he found joy in volunteer work, giving Communion as a Eucharistic Minister at his local church, nursing home, and to the home-bound. He also loved his work for Angel Flight which provides free air transport for passengers in need of medical treatment.

Besides spending time with family and friends, Murph had a passion for walking all over Manhattan, reading, playing card games, watching Villanova basketball games, talking about his love for Ireland, being involved in his church and enjoying breakfasts and dinners out with friends. Murph had an energetic personality, was full of stories to tell, jokes to share and laughs to give. He was loved by many and touched the lives of others fortunate enough to know him.

He is survived by his three children, Elizabeth, Douglas, Margaret Mary (nee McQuillan), his four grandchildren, Michael, Max, Genevieve and Luke and his sister, Margaret.
